
Effective July 1, 2007, the Massachusetts Health Care Reform law requires all Massachusetts residents who are 18 or older to have health insurance. If you decide to waive health insurance coverage, you will be required to complete a Commonwealth of Massachusetts Health Insurance Responsibility Disclosure Form (HIRD) (PDF) as part of the enrollment process. This form requests you to indicate if you have alternative health insurance coverage and also requests your acknowledgement of the requirements to have medical coverage and the penalties for non-compliance. You will be asked to complete a new HIRD form each plan year.
Each year, by January 31, the University’s health insurance carrier will send a 1099-HC form to each plan subscriber who resides in Massachusetts. You and your dependents (if applicable) will need this form to file your state income tax return.
